What does ICD-10 code M01 mean?

ICD-10-CM code M01 represents “Direct infections of joint in infectious and parasitic diseases classified elsewhere”. It is classified under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ue and is a non-billable header code. Use a more specific child code for billing purposes.

Is M01 a billable code?

No, M01 is a non-billable header code. You need to use one of its more specific child codes for billing. There are 1 child codes under M01.

What chapter is M01 in?

M01 is in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ue (codes M00-M99).

What codes cannot be used with M01?

M01 has Excludes1 notes indicating codes that cannot be used together with it, including: arthropathy in Lyme disease (A69.23); gonococcal arthritis (A54.42); meningococcal arthritis (A39.83); and 8 more.

What is the ICD-11 equivalent of M01?

M01 maps to the ICD-11 code: FA10.Z (Direct infections of joint, unspecified).
